With its Green Opera programme, La Monnaie is committed to reducing its ecological footprint as much as possible. However, we cannot do this alone, as our carbon emission calculations show that the displacement of our audience also has a non-negligible CO2 impact. With the following initiatives, we hope to convince a growing number of spectators to opt for a form of soft mobility when making their way to our venues. Pass by at our mobility desk in the Entrance Hall and we inform you on all these actions and how you can profit from them.
Bike:
You can park your folding bicycle safely and free of charge in La Monnaie's cloakroom. For all other bicycles, take advantage of the secured cyclo parking facilities De Brouckère and Bourse. No subscription is required; cyclists can simply park their vehicles for a set period of time and pay by the hour. In addition to the free first four hours, you then only pay €1.25 per 24 hours. Only people who created an account and added a payment method (which can be done on site) or people who already have a subscription to another cyclo parking facility can access it.

Public Transport Buddies: After each opera, you can walk with other La Monnaie visitors to three Brussels transport hubs: Brussels-Central, De Brouckère (metro) and De Brouckère (tram). Before the opera or during the interval, drop by the mobility desk in the Entrance hall, let us know which group you wish to join, and afterwards meet your buddies there at the signposted meeting point!

La Monnaie is committed to making its Theatre and performances more accessible to all visitors.
Discounts
Disabled people and their helpers benefit from a 25% discount on the price of all our operas, symphony concerts and recitals. Please contact MM Tickets to benefit from this special rate.
Wheelchair users
La Monnaie’s Main Auditorium not only offers excellent acoustics but is also a wonderful setting for our shows. It is indeed part of the city’s historic heritage. However, this listed gem also has its drawbacks: the Main Auditorium was not designed with wheelchair access in mind, and there is little room for adaptation. Nevertheless, we do our utmost to ensure that wheelchair users can also enjoy our shows to the full.
- We have two places reserved for wheelchairs in the Main Auditorium. They are located at the back of the parterre. From there, the surtitle displays are unfortunately not visible, except when they are set up on the side balconies.
- A ticket for a wheelchair seat costs €30. Tickets must be purchased from MM Tickets. When booking, please state the size of your wheelchair and whether you require special assistance.
- Wheelchair users can make use of the adapted sanitary facilities in our Theatre.
- Guided tours of our Theatre and Workshops are accessible to wheelchair users, who also benefit from a 50% discount.
- For safety reasons, we are unable to accommodate wheelchairs in the aisles of the Main Auditorium. It is therefore not possible to leave your wheelchair behind you or next to you and use a seat not reserved for wheelchairs.
- If you wish to book a place for a wheelchair for one of our shows outside La Monnaie, please contact MM Tickets and we will be happy to look into the possibilities.

Audio description
Each season, La Monnaie provides a number of performances with an audio description. This allows the visually impaired operagoer to listen to a description of what is happening on the stage via headphones. A commentator’s voice summarises the action live, situates it in time and place, and provides details about clothing, hairdos and facial expressions – all these elements contribute to the telling of the tale and are part of a high-quality opera experience.

There is no dress code, so wear the clothes you want to wear. You could, of course, make the evening that bit more festive by digging out a special outfit. But there is absolutely no obligation to do so: if you’re happy in a sweater, jeans, and sneakers, that’s fine by us.
In general, children can attend performances at La Monnaie from the age of 5. We even have a preferential rate for under 15s (booking only via MM Tickets). We do not have a creche available.
